Официальное название
Pilot Study of Quercetin Patients With Dyskeratosis Congenita/Telomere Biology Disorders
Обзор
The purpose of this study is to see if a vitamin-like substance called quercetin is safe for people who have a rare condition called Dyskeratosis congenita (DC) or telomere biology disorders (TBD).
Подробное описание
The purpose of this study is to see if a vitamin-like substance called quercetin is safe for people who have a rare condition called Dyskeratosis congenita (DC) or telomere biology disorders (TBD). This study is a single arm, open-label pilot study. There is no randomization. This study will enroll approximately 12 patients with DC/TBD who will be treated with quercetin for 24 weeks.
Вмешательства
- Препарат Quercetin
Quercetin (3, 30, 40, 5, 7-pentahydroxyflavone) is a naturally occurring antioxidant that belongs to a group of polyphenolic compounds known as flavonoids. Quercetin is routinely available as an over-the-counter product due to it being a nutritional supplement. However, for the purpose of the study, it will be purchased in the powder form from PCCA (supplied as 96% quercetin dihydrate) and stored and distributed by the investigational pharmacy at CCHMC using standard operational procedures. Первичные конечные точки
- Number of Participants With Treatment-Related Adverse Events as Assessed by CTCAE v5.0 [Срок оценки: 24 weeks]
- Number of Participants who Discontinue Quercetin Due to Lack of Feasibility as defined in the protocol [Срок оценки: 24 weeks]
Критерии участия
Критерии включения
- Diagnosis of DC/TBD deficiency as defined by at least one of the following:
- Age adjusted mean-telomere length of <1 percentile in all tested peripheral blood cells such as granulocytes, lymphocytes, B-cells, naïve T-cells, memory T-cells, and NK cells
- A pathogenic or likely pathogenic mutation in DKC1, TERC, TERT, NOP10, NHP2, TINF2, CTC1, PARN, RTEL1, ACD, NAF1, ZCCHC8, or WRAP53
- Patients ≥ 2.0 years of age\*
- The first three enrolled patients must be ≥ 10.0 years of age
- Able to take medication orally
Критерии исключения
- Renal failure requiring dialysis
- Total bilirubin >3 mg/dl and/or SGPT >300 at time of enrollment, unless elevation thought to be related to DC/TBD
- Patients who have received quercetin or any over-the-counter antioxidant supplementation within last 1 month
- Patients currently taking androgen therapy
- Patients receiving digoxin therapy, who are unable to discontinue treatment due to medical reasons
- Patients receiving fluoroquinolone therapy, who are unable to discontinue treatment due to medical reasons
- Patients who are pregnant or breastfeeding or are at risk of pregnancy and are unable to use acceptable methods of birth control during the length of the study
- Patients with morphologic or cytogenetic evidence of myelodysplasia or leukemia.
- Patients needing to start or actively receiving radiation therapy, chemotherapy or immunotherapy for treatment of SCC or other cancers.
- Patients with unstable disease status or other medical issues requiring hospitalization or rapid escalation of medical care
- Participating in another therapeutic study for DC/TBD
- Patients who are in the early post-stem cell transplant period (i.e. first 6 months post-transplant)
